Sensitivity standards help confirm whether a mycobacterial NAT workflow can detect targets near the assay limit. A dual-level format is useful for checking performance across different challenge levels and supporting method consistency studies.
Common challenges in sensitivity verification include:
- Low-level input verification: Studies require defined material near the detection threshold.
- Multi-level performance assessment: A single reference level may not fully reflect workflow behavior.
- Full-workflow evaluation: Verification often needs to include extraction and downstream PCR.
- Reference material consistency: Reliable studies depend on standardized input material.
